Tenn. Code Ann. § 47-25-101: Agreements in restraint of trade

All arrangements, contracts, agreements, trusts, or combinations between persons or corporations made with a view to lessen, or which tend to lessen, full and free competition in trade or commerce affecting this state, and all arrangements, contracts, agreements, trusts, or combinations between persons or corporations designed or which tend to advance, reduce, or control the price or the cost to the producer or the consumer of any product or service in trade or commerce affecting this state, are declared to be against public policy, unlawful, and void.
